On 05/16/2009, Neeraj Sahu wrote:
> Is there any way to access that windows sharable folder using user id
> and password but only with Linux command.
Be careful what you assume. Cygwin's 'mount' has syntactic similarities
to the Linux/Unix 'mount' but is semanticly quite different.
There is no command-line facility in Cygwin which will perform the
function you are referring to here.
